Sixty-eight minutes.

That is the brand new magic quantity at Caring Seasons Well being, a house well being care supplier primarily based in Fort Mill, South Carolina.

Utilizing their previous EMR, the Caring Seasons staff spent three to 4 hours recording. With their new AI system from Tallio, it solely takes them 68 minutes. Duties that took 30 to 90 minutes now take 10 to fifteen minutes. EMR updates that used to take three months are taking place in hours and even minutes.

“This method from Tallio – it is a true assistant,” mentioned Rhonda Oakes, director of medical operations at Caring Seasons. “I’ve by no means seen something prefer it. The working system clearly consists of the required regulatory parts as I navigate the nursing course of, permitting me to concentrate on what issues most: the particular person in entrance of me.”

Tallio is a healthcare expertise firm introducing the idea of turning house care suppliers into AI-native entities. Their slogan, “You Do not Want an EMR Anymore,” is a daring assertion that some may label as an exaggeration or a terrifying reality.

Oakes understands when you suppose it is the latter. She disagrees when you suppose it is the previous.

“What was the unique function of the digital medical file or digital well being file?” says Oakes. “It was a device that was supposed to supply a superb medical workflow that might seamlessly align regulatory outcomes and assist us preserve compliance by offering a device for knowledge seize on the bedside. So if that’s what an EMR is meant to be, it has missed its mark as most have created compliance documentation that interrupts medical care.”

Tallio’s system makes medicine adherence an automated byproduct of medical excellence. So whereas Oakes was skilled to view knowledge assortment in hospice and residential care as “portray the image” of the affected person, Tallio drastically reduces the time spent portray, so to talk.

“I can full the admissions course of in 68 minutes,” she says. “And I can paint that image, my narrative abstract of ‘why hospice, why now’, primarily based on my medical findings in 5 minutes.”

How AI can scale back documentation time by 75%

Oakes raises an necessary level concerning the origins of an EMR. For many years, EMRs promised effectivity. They delivered clicks, shapes and fragmentation dressed up as innovation.

However what began as instruments to streamline care grew to become a barrier to that.

Margins are shrinking. Compliance is reactive. Docs spend extra time doc then maintain it. Add-on options solely solved the signs and induced much more fragmentation.

Every layer has been added complexity and prices. The system has grow to be heavier, not smarter. This isn’t a workflow downside; it’s a basic downside. And you’ll’t repair a damaged basis by constructing on high of it.

“Within the Nineteen Nineties, paper maps had been all we had,” says Matt Challberg, founder and CEO of Tallio. “They could not scale, so the trade moved to EMRs. That moved the work from paper to screens, however the course of itself did not change. It merely turned paper complexity into digital complexity.”

Now Tallio is bringing synthetic intelligence into that compliance and knowledge assortment area. These AI-native businesses are attaining documentation time reductions of 75% or extra, with near-perfect clear declare charges. These healthcare suppliers, like Caring Seasons, don’t use AI-powered EHRs. They’re utilizing AI to utterly exchange their EMR.

“With Tallio, the machine would not work for the machine, it really works for you,” says Oakes. “And you’ll really use your strengths, your true abilities, the the reason why you wished to work within the post-acute care atmosphere, and do the work that you simply wish to do.”
